I can tell you what Coach Brian Michaelson said on post game radio regarding NWG. He said Nigel came down on his hip. He will receive treatment tonight and tomorrow and most likely will be good to go Monday. How he made that determination I do not know but in my heart of hearts I hope he knew what he was talking about. In any event I'm assuming the crutches are not indicative of a season ender.

Breathing a sigh of relief.
From Meehan's Twitter:
Williams-Goss pt. 1: "Just went baseline and went up and got hit. When I landed, I kind of landed on my hip, but I think I’ll be alright."
Williams-Goss pt 2: "I think it's something like a bone bruise. I don’t expect it to be anything more serious than that."
